Videos of the Week June 16th


I'm bringing a truly unique top five this week. Led by some quirkiness, a few music videos, and a whole lot of race related content, it was an eclectic week. As long as you can get over the fact that Jimmy Fallon and Miley Cyrus didn't do the best job at concealing their true identities, their NYC Subway performance was one of the stand outs from this week. Pretty crazy how quickly a crowd gathered, mostly for Miley, but when Jimmy unmasked himself, people started losing it and breaking out their iPhones.

In the world of music videos, The Weeknd and Buddy released new videos for singles. Of the two, I enjoyed Buddy and Kaytranada's dance heavy video the most. Regarding race it was apropos that the Black Panther trailer came out the week that Ice Cube went on Bill Maher's show to school him on use of the N word. To Bill's credit, he owned up to his mistake and seemed like he was open minded enough to listen to what Cube was saying. As a side note, I really hope Black Panther continues Marvel's dominance in comic book cinema in 2018. Thanks to Wonder Woman, they actually might have competition from DC moving forward...#BlackPanther
